What an invoice example template is and why it matters

An invoice example template is a preformatted billing document that standardizes the presentation of goods or services, pricing, taxes, payment terms, and contact details for recurring use. Using a template reduces manual entry, enforces consistent line item structure, and ensures invoices include required legal and tax information. Templates can be adapted for different clients, currencies, and jurisdictions while preserving a consistent signature and approval workflow. When integrated with an eSignature platform, templates streamline approval, automate reminders, and capture a tamper-evident audit trail for each signed invoice.

Common challenges when adopting invoice templates

  • Inconsistent line items and tax calculations across versions lead to client confusion and payment delays.
  • Manually updating client-specific terms increases time per invoice and raises the chance of input errors.
  • Lack of integrated signing and tracking creates uncertainty about approval status and payment scheduling.
  • Poor version control risks sending outdated terms or incorrect amounts without an authoritative audit trail.

Core template features that improve invoicing accuracy

Choose template features that reduce manual steps and improve recordkeeping when preparing invoices for electronic signing.

Calculated fields

Automatic line-item totals, tax computations, and discounts reduce manual errors and ensure numeric consistency across the invoice before sending.

Conditional fields

Show or hide fields based on client type or service selection so invoices remain concise and include only relevant billing information.

Reusable templates

Store pre-approved invoice layouts for specific projects or clients to speed generation and maintain consistent contract language and payment terms.

Signature placeholders

Designate signer roles, signature blocks, and date fields to ensure correct execution order and capture signer metadata for compliance.

Industry examples showing invoice example template use

Practical examples illustrate how templates fit into common billing scenarios across industries.

Professional Services

A consulting firm uses an invoice example template to itemize hourly work and expenses for client engagements

  • Template includes standardized line items and fixed tax handling
  • Reduces billing disputes and accelerates collections

Resulting in faster month-end close and clearer client communication.

Healthcare Provider

A clinic issues invoices that combine patient fees, insurance adjustments, and co-pay details in a single template

  • Template captures provider identifiers and CPT codes
  • Improves reconciliation with payer remittances and reduces coding errors

Leading to fewer claim denials and steadier revenue cycles.

Best practices for secure and accurate invoice templates

Apply consistent formatting, validation, and record controls to reduce disputes and maintain compliance when using invoice example templates.

Standardize line-item descriptions and tax codes
Use clear, consistent descriptions and designated tax code fields to ensure accurate accounting, make reconciliation simpler, and reduce misinterpretation by clients and auditors.
Validate totals with automated calculations
Configure calculated fields to verify subtotal, tax, and final amounts automatically so invoices are accurate before sending and reduce downstream corrections.
Include explicit payment terms and late fees
State due dates, acceptable payment methods, and any late fee schedules to limit ambiguity and improve on-time payment performance while documenting terms for disputes.
Keep audit-friendly versioning and retention
Maintain template version histories and store signed invoices with immutable audit logs to support compliance, tax reporting, and internal audits.
